Responsibilities
- Develop and maintain project job costs, forecasting, revenue, and cash flows.
- Maintain project level cost and budget utilizing company provided software including identification of cost adjustments, quantities, forecast cost to complete, and budget revisions.
- Support subcontractor and service agreement payments.
- Develop and facilitate payment applications to the client.
- Investigate problems and/or reported incidents; identify and recommend solutions/alternatives as appropriate.
- Assemble cost and schedule proposals for change order work.
- Prepare and coordinate reports for internal and external stakeholders.
- Participate in project decisions regarding cost and scheduling.
- Provide additional support to Scheduler when needed on an ad hoc basis.
- Assume additional responsibilities as directed by the Project Management Team.
